Sweet and Savory Crispy Tteokgangjeong

Introducing a recipe for delicious tteokgangjeong (syrup-coated rice cakes) that are crispy on the outside and chewy on the inside, perfect for your child’s snack. It’s simple yet offers a fantastic taste that will captivate everyone’s palate.

Main Ingredients

  • 6 mini gara tteok (rice cakes, approx. 150g)
  • 2 swirls of perilla oil (approx. 2 Tbsp)

Cooking Instructions

Step 1

First, prepare the mini rice cakes. Cut them into 3 equal pieces each, making them easy to eat. If they’re too small, they might break while frying, and if they’re too large, the sauce won’t coat them well, so cutting them into thirds is ideal.

Step 2

Now it’s time to cook the rice cakes. Heat 2 swirls (about 2 Tbsp) of perilla oil in a frying pan over medium-low heat. Perilla oil adds a nutty aroma that enhances the flavor of the tteokgangjeong.

Step 3

Add the cut rice cakes to the preheated pan. Roll them around and fry until they are golden brown and slightly crispy. It’s important to fry them slowly until the surface becomes lightly crisp and develops an appetizing golden color. Once fried, set the rice cakes aside on a separate plate.

Step 4

With the heat completely turned off in the pan used for frying the rice cakes, add 1/2 Tbsp soy sauce, 2 swirls (about 2 Tbsp) of corn syrup, and 1/2 Tbsp ginger syrup. (If you don’t have ginger syrup, you can omit it or use honey as a substitute.) Let the sauce simmer gently using the residual heat, stirring to combine the ingredients. This prevents the sauce from burning and creates a smooth sauce.

Step 5

With the heat still off, return the pre-fried rice cakes to the pan. Toss them well by shaking the pan or gently stirring with a spatula until the sauce evenly coats each piece. The rice cakes will start to glisten with the sauce coating.

Step 6

Finally, turn the heat back on to low and stir for about 10 more seconds to finish. This will slightly reduce the sauce, coating the rice cakes perfectly and completing your delicious tteokgangjeong. Be careful not to overcook, as the rice cakes can become hard. Enjoy the ultimate taste of crispy outside and chewy inside when served warm!
